Bin Collection Changes for 32,000 Homes Across Weymouth Area
Thousands of households across Weymouth and the surrounding areas will see changes to their waste and recycling collection days from 13 April as new bin routes are introduced. Dorset Council has confirmed that around 32,000 homes in Weymouth, Portland, Chickerell and Osmington will be affected by the updates. The changes follow a review of how […]
Weymouth shop ordered to close after repeated illicit tobacco sales
By Jake Brewer- BAJ Accredited Journalist Weymouth, Dorset — 27 February 2026A local retail premises in Weymouth has been ordered to shut for three months following repeated sales of illicit tobacco products, including instances involving children, after enforcement action by Dorset Council’s Trading Standards team and Dorset Police. Temporary Closure of Mercery Road in Weymouth Announced
Dorset Council has confirmed that a section of Mercery Road in Weymouth will be temporarily closed in January 2026 to allow essential works to take place.
